LLY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2021 in Review

1,949 of the 5,696 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Eli Lilly (LLY) for Q1 2021, worth a combined $148B — up 11% from $134B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 180 funds opened new LLY positions and 100 closed out — a net gain of 80 holders — while 676 added to existing stakes and 776 trimmed.

The largest buyer was T. Rowe Price Associates, adding an estimated $2.75B. The largest seller was JP Morgan Chase, cutting an estimated $818M.
